Transaction 6e86ba8d41ff79fdf2b6706b0c7109e757d14e82584fdbbcff221ccf86e35f7a
4 Input
2 Outputs
- 6e86ba8d41ff79fdf2b6706b0c7109e757d14e82584fdbbcff221ccf86e35f7a:0
- 6e86ba8d41ff79fdf2b6706b0c7109e757d14e82584fdbbcff221ccf86e35f7a:1
value 18382084
address 16AeNa2WF1PM4Zd4yQi952KEuFmQUgxKLL
value 1000916
address 12Utj96y6U5ZuwVuKvdXKtXRJzBoc6vLEp